| chooseRandomNode(Set, boolean) |  | 0% |  | 0% | 5 | 5 | 10 | 10 | 1 | 1 |
| choose(DatanodeDescriptor, Set) |  | 0% |  | 0% | 5 | 5 | 8 | 8 | 1 | 1 |
| createProvidedStorage(DatanodeStorage) |  | 0% |  | 0% | 3 | 3 | 5 | 5 | 1 | 1 |
| chooseRandom(DatanodeStorageInfo[]) |  | 0% |  | 0% | 3 | 3 | 7 | 7 | 1 | 1 |
| remove(DatanodeDescriptor) |  | 0% |  | 0% | 3 | 3 | 6 | 6 | 1 | 1 |
| ProvidedStorageMap.ProvidedDescriptor() |  | 0% | | n/a | 1 | 1 | 5 | 5 | 1 | 1 |
| getProvidedStorage(DatanodeDescriptor, DatanodeStorage) |  | 0% | | n/a | 1 | 1 | 3 | 3 | 1 | 1 |
| addBlockToBeReplicated(Block, DatanodeStorageInfo[]) |  | 0% |  | 0% | 2 | 2 | 5 | 5 | 1 | 1 |
| equals(Object) |  | 0% |  | 0% | 3 | 3 | 1 | 1 | 1 | 1 |
| static {...} |  | 0% |  | 0% | 2 | 2 | 1 | 1 | 1 | 1 |
| choose(DatanodeDescriptor) |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| activeProvidedDatanodes() |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| hashCode() |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| toString() |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| getNetworkLocation() |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|
| getName() |  | 0% | | n/a | 1 | 1 | 1 | 1 | 1 | 1 |